Identification and Expression Analysis of GH3 Gene Family Members in Potato(Solanum tuberosum)
The expression of Gretchen Hagen 3(GH3)genes plays an important role in plant growth and development and response to biotic stresses.In this study,the potato(Solanum tuberosum)cultivar'Qingshu 9'as the materical for identification and bioinformatics analysis of GH3 family members,and their expression patterns were analysed in potato different tissues and in response to salicylic acid(SA),Methyl jasmonate(MeJA)and gibberellin A3(GA3)and Phytophthora infestans stresses.Promoter cis-acting element analyses showed that StGH3 family members contained a large number of hormone-related acting elements,speculated that it had potential function in response to biotic and abiotic stresses.Tissue specific analysis showed that StGH3.4 and StGH3.5 genes were highly expressed in roots,StGH3.8 was highly expressed in stems,and StGH3.10 and StGH3.16 were highly expressed in leaves.StGH3 family members were regulated under SA,MeJA,GA3 and P.infestans stress treatments and showed different expression patterns.The StGH3.1,StGH3.5,and StGH3.8 genes responded more strongly to the P.infestans treatment.This study provides a scientific basis for subsequent studies of StGH3 genes function.
